# Template rendering perf notes (Dovetail CMS): we cache compiled
# templates per-locale now, which cut render time roughly in half.
# Reviewer heads-up — the cache key includes the theme version, so
# bumping themes invalidates everything at once. Benchmarks read
# fixture pages from the metrics database via the connection below.

primary connection of yagep-kahip = redis://giliel_svc:zYiKsLL2PLpfPL@db-348f.xolmarsys.corp:5432/fenwyn

Quarterly Planning Note — Budget Request

Hi finance folks,

Heads-up on the Q2 ask from the Pinewick platform team: they're requesting an uplift of roughly 18% to cover the Granholm tooling migration and two additional contractor seats. The case is solid — current tooling costs are eating us alive in maintenance hours. I'd like a provisional line in the draft plan before the steering review. The sensitive context behind the timing sits in the note below.

confidential, bahof-yaweg: Headcount on the Kaseth team goes from 32 to 109 by the end of January. Gross margin on Kaseth came in at 46 percent against a plan of 45 percent.

Before regenerating fixtures, always confirm the schema version pinned in the factory manifest matches the target database, otherwise generation will silently produce mismatched columns. Regeneration is safe to run repeatedly; it is fully idempotent and never touches production data. When invoking the generator manually, it must be started with exactly the configuration values given below.

deployment values, hahaf-fahop:
zorwyn:
  log_level: debug
  metrics_host: metrics.zorwyn.tolvaqlabs.internal
  pool_size: 8

Visitor policy — night shift, Hallowen Depot

Visitors on site after 22:00 must remain with their escort at all times. If a visitor requires first aid, take them directly to the first-aid room off the north corridor; do not treat anyone in the loading area. Log every use of the room in the incident book, including minor cases. The room is kept locked overnight, so open it with the code below.

staff pass of kawip-hawef = bdg-QLP-2